Online Journalists experiences are not quite different from majority of citizens who earlier decried the selective, marginalization and politicisation of welfare of Citizens palliative packages distributions by the Federal, State and Local governments during covid-19 lockdown in Nigeria.

The Governments has distributed various Relief disbursement Collation forms and other related palliative materials without any consideration for online and commmunity media practitioners.

Reacting to the marginalization of Journalists by the Federal, State and Local governments and lawmakers during the covid-19 lockdown to the online media practitioners, the President of the Association of Online Media Practitioners of Nigeria, (AMPON), Wole Arisekola said online journalists are also frontline workers as well.

That due to the status of their work, they have to be part of governerment’s palliative and protection.

“Online journalists are also frontline workers, they need to be part of Government’s palliatives and be Protected,” Arisekola affirmed.
